Text: Romans 12:1-2
Key Verse: Romans 12:2, “And do not be conformed to this world, but be transformed by the renewing of your mind, that you may prove what is that good and acceptable and perfect will of God.” (NKJV)

The transformed life is rooted in righteousness. Christ died to give us grace to live a righteous and holy life. It is not a cheap grace that makes people to live a defeated and sinful life. It is the transforming grace that gives you power to live above sin. It is the grace that purifies us within, makes us live a life that God Himself Has ordained. Christ did not die on the Cross of Calvary, went through all manner of torture on the cross, for us to live a sinful and shameful life. Jesus died to give us power to live above sin and also, that sin will not have dominion over us (Romans 6:14).

There is an ongoing battle for our bodies. Although, Jesus Christ has defeated the old slave master, sin, yet it continues to raise its head, attacking Christians. It tries to take hold of us, but we are not supposed to let it have power over us. Sin will have dominion over your life as much as you allow it, so, you must war against it — not let it reign over your mortal body. Paul says fight against sin and do not let it rule over your body (Romans 6:12). You cannot say you are ready for the rapture if you live in sin. The transformed life cannot allow sin to control his/her body or allow any part of his body to be tool of unrighteousness.

Our bodies should be tool of righteousness. Today in our world, some people are filled with hatred, jealousy, envy, contentions, quarrels, selfish ambitions and heresies. Some are busy committing murder of all types — abortion, outright killing of human beings, poisoning people, among others.

Some have given themselves to drunkenness and are under the control of all types of alcoholic drinks. Some have taken to drugs such as Indian hemp, cocaine, tramadol and others. Some sniff and smoke theirs. Despite the dangers, these people feel satisfied and continue in their habit. We should not forget that all things are naked before whom we must give account to (Hebrews 4:13). The Bible said that friendship with the world is enmity with God (James 4:4). Live a holy life; a life acceptable to God, which is your spiritual worship.

Paul writing to his son Titus in Titus 2:11 said, the grace of God that brings salvation has appeared to all men. When you give your life to Jesus Christ, you become a child of God, your name is in the Lamb’s Book of Life and you are running your heavenly race under the father, son and the Holy Spirit. As soon as that is done, you must live a holy life: the transformed life. I beseech you, I beg you my brother, I beg you my sister, I kneel before you, if you are living a contrary life, please repent and give your life to Christ before it will be too late for you. In the Old Testament, God says these people draw near to Me with their lips, but their hearts are far away from Me (Mathew 15:8) and God keeps saying My son give Me your heart that you may learn to observe My Ways (Proverbs 23:26).
